titleOfInvention Oil-repellent waterproof breathable filter and method for producing the same
abstract An oil-repellent waterproof breathable filter that has a small environmental load and has excellent liquid repellency against ketone solvents and ester solvents, and a method for producing the same. An oil-repellent waterproof breathable filter in which a base material having a continuous porous structure is coated with a coating material containing a fluoropolymer having a perfluoroalkyl group, wherein the fluoropolymer has an α-position. Is a chlorine atom, has a structural unit based on an acrylate having a C1-C6 perfluoroalkyl group, and the proportion of the structural unit is 40 to 100% by mass in all the structural units. Moreover, the manufacturing method of the oil-repellent waterproof breathable filter which processes the said base material with the oil-repellent waterproofing agent composition containing the said coating material and a medium, and removes the said medium.
